Some ideas for web based Secondary Research



Some ideas for web based Secondary Research

I've been working on collecting a set of suitable IA online resources recently. They may be a starting point for IB Business and Management students for various tasks - such as
• IA (HL and SL) Secondary research
• Choosing a suitable IA SL topic
• Choosing a suitable EE topic

It’s NOT a comprehensive list, but I hope this helps if you are stuck on getting a start on suitable secondary sources…....

Remember … before you start surfing….
• The following links are respected, and are a good place to start, but DON’T trust something just because it’s on a website!
• You are expected to select a range of secondary research sources. As well as these external sources, you should look for internal sources of secondary research - company end of year reports etc
• ALL secondary research MUST be current (i.e. published in the last 2 years)
